As you review the school rankings data, please be aware that some of the information from certain demographics is missing. The reason for this omission is that the data has been redacted from the source data itself due to low population samples in these specific demographic groups.

Redacting data from low population samples is a necessary step to ensure the reliability and accuracy of the results, as small sample sizes may not be representative of the broader population. Additionally, this measure helps protect the privacy of individuals belonging to these demographic groups.

Open Quote For many the alternative to Henry Abbott is Danbury High School, New Milford High School, New Fairfield High School. Compared to the other schools, Henry Abbott is smaller, spends a lot less money on sports, and graduates students who are capable of practicing a trade immediately.

One poster indicated there was no AP course at Henry Abbott, which is true. Instead if you take the electrical program as an example, you come out tested to be an electrician with between 1,000 and 1,500 hours credited of the time you will need to serve to become an electrician (becoming an electrician requires 4,000 hours in Connecticut).

Graduating Danbury High School often qualifies you to attend the local state university, community college, live with mom or dad, or work a minimum wage job. All this is possible with a degree from Henry Abbott, but is less common.

A non-Abbott High School graduate in the greater Danbury area can pay $18,000 to Ridley Lowell and after another school year, obtain the education, but not the time in trade, electrical program graduates of Henry Abbott already have at graducation and for which they paid nothing.

Vocational schools are not respected in Fairfield County Connecticut, which is unfortunate, as so many homes need plumbers, electricians, carpenters and other tradesmen to service and maintain their mini estates. Close Quote

About Students eligible for discounted/free lunch:

The National School Lunch Program (NSLP) provides low-cost or free meals to students in U.S. public and nonprofit private schools based on household income. Those with incomes below 130% of the poverty line receive free lunch, while those between 130% and 185% qualify for reduced-price lunch. The percentage of students receiving free or reduced-price lunch serves as a marker for poverty, as it reflects the socioeconomic status of families in a given school or district. A higher FRPL rate typically indicates a higher concentration of low-income families, suggesting that the school or district may face additional challenges in providing adequate resources and support for student success.

About Student-Teacher Ratio

Student/teacher ratio is calculated by dividing the total number of students by the total number of full-time equivalent teachers. Please note that a smaller student/teacher ratio does not necessarily translate to smaller class size. In some instances, schools hire teachers part time, and some teachers are hired for specialized instruction with very small class sizes. These and other factors contribute to the student/teacher ratio. Note: For private schools, Student/teacher ratio may not include Pre-Kindergarten.
